noun
leprosy patient; person with leprosy
Medical term. The preferred modern expression is ハンセン病患者 (Hansen's disease patient). The term らい患者 is still encountered but can be considered outdated or insensitive in some contexts.
See also: ハンセン病患者
かつて、らい患者は隔離されていた。
In the past, leprosy patients were isolated.
現在では「らい患者」よりも「ハンセン病患者」という呼び方が推奨されている。
Nowadays, the term 'Hansen's disease patient' is recommended over 'leprosy patient'.
The modern, non-discriminatory term for a person with Hansen's disease (leprosy). Preferred in medical and social contexts.
Compound of らい (癩, leprosy) and 患者 (patient). The reading らい is from the on'yomi of 癩.
